I am using magneto 2Magento-2.1.7. I'mI am trying to move where the billing address is set by default it is set on the payment page and I would like to move this to the shipping methods section.
Here is my checkout_index_index.xml:
<item name="component" xsi:type="string">uiComponent</item>
<item name="displayArea" xsi:type="string">before-shipping-method-form</item>
<item name="children" xsi:type="array">
<item name="billing-address" xsi:type="array">
<item name="component" xsi:type="string">Magento_Checkout/js/view/payment/default</item>
<item name="component" xsi:type="string">Magento_Checkout/js/view/billing-address</item>
<item name="displayArea" xsi:type="string">billing-address</item>
<item name="dataScope" xsi:type="string">afterMethods</item>
<item name="provider" xsi:type="string">checkoutProvider</item>
<item name="config" xsi:type="array">
<item name="template" xsi:type="string">Magento_Checkout/billing-address</item>
</item>
</item>
</item>
This is loading the checkbox and label but the form is empty